FIM Superbike World Championship Misano, San Marino, Italy June 25 Race One Results: 1. Troy BAYLISS (Duc 999F06), 25 laps, 40:06.480 2. James TOSELAND (Hon CBR1000RR), -6.943 seconds 3. Yukio KAGAYAMA (Suz GSX-R1000), -10.141 seconds 4. Alex BARROS (Hon CBR1000RR), -15.017 seconds 5. Noriyuki HAGA (Yam YZF-R1), -15.376 seconds 6. Regis LACONI (Kaw ZX-10R), -16.763 seconds 7. Lorenzo LANZI (Duc 999F06), -23.857 seconds 8. Fonsi NIETO (Kaw ZX-10R), -34.167 seconds 9. Ruben XAUS (Duc 999F05), -35.254 seconds 10. Norick ABE (Yam YZF-R1), -35.335 seconds 11. Karl MUGGERIDGE (Hon CBR1000RR), -39.423 seconds 12. Sebastien GIMBERT (Yam YZF-R1), -39.609 seconds 13. Fabien FORET (Suz GSX-R1000), -39.755 seconds 14. Vittorio IANNUZZO (Suz GSX-R1000), -44.065 seconds 15. Roberto ROLFO (Duc 999F05), -48.495 seconds, ride-through penalty for jumped start 16. Andrew PITT (Yam YZF-R1), -48.587 seconds, crash 17. Ivan CLEMENTI (Duc 999RS), -50.158 seconds 18. Josh BROOKES (Kaw ZX-10R), -52.883 seconds 19. Norine BRIGNOLA (Duc 999RS), -60.319 seconds 20. Pierfrancesco CHILI (Hon CBR1000RR), -73.185 seconds 21. Craig JONES (Foggy Petronas FP1), -75.929 seconds 22. Lorenzo ALFONSI (Duc 999RS), -76.972 seconds 23. Gianluca NANNELLI (Hon CBR1000RR), -8 laps, DNF, mechanial 24. Steve MARTIN (Foggy Petronas FP1), -9 laps, DNF, mechanical 25. Troy CORSER (Suz GSX-R1000), -10 laps, DNF, crash 26. Chris WALKER (Kaw ZX-10R), -13 laps, DNF, crash 27. Marco BORCIANI (Duc 999F05), -13 laps, DNF, mechanical 28. Michel FABRIZIO (Hon CBR1000RR), -18 laps, DNF, crash 29. Shinichi NAKATOMI (Yam YZF-R1), -23 laps, DNF, crash
